Canadian Who Was in an ‘American Pie’ Video Says ICE Held Her for 12 Days
Jasmine Mooney, 35, said she was put “in chains” after immigration enforcement officers flagged her visa application paperwork. The former actress was finally allowed to return to Vancouver.
Jasmine Mooney, a Canadian national who appeared in “American Pie Presents: The Book of Love,” said she was put “in chains” after immigration officers on the U.S.-Mexico border flagged her work permit paperwork. Mooney said she was confined for two days in a small cell at a border station.

Good read! I recommend Blackmar's *Manhattan for Rent* (1991). She writes of the centuries-long housing crisis. In the early 1800s, “newspapers, visitors, and residents reported that the city did not have enough housing” and “the tone of such complaints had gained a new urgency” by 1840 (p. 183).
